<script type="text/javascript">
//通过js内置的函数构造器创建函数
var func=new Function(‘a‘,‘b‘,‘return a+b‘);
alert(typeof func);
alert(func(3,5));
//和下面的效果一样
var func1=function(a,b){return a+b};
alert(func1(6,7));
//作用域链
var a=1;
function test(){
var b=2;
return a;
}
test();
alter(b);
原文:http://www.cnblogs.com/sunliyuan/p/6266469.html